Abstract
⺠Polypyrrole (PPy) with photonic structures from butterfly wings was synthesized based on a two-step templating and in situ polymerization process. ⺠The hierarchical structures down to nanometer level were kept in the resultant PPy replicas. ⺠The PPy replicas exhibit brilliant color due to Bragg diffraction through its ordered periodic structures. ⺠The PPy replicas showed a much higher biological activity compared with common PPy powders as a biosensor.
